My 64 Chevelle 283/t350 has been sitting all winter and started from time to time. I went to start it the other day and it cranked a few turns and then nothing. The battery is fully charged, I have a new positive battery cable to the starter already installed. The old one looked bad so I replaced it. The car has headers that were installed about 6 months ago, and the car hasn't been run very much. Could the starter have gone bad that quick due to header heat? Is there a good way to test the starter, and to verify that I have good voltage to it? Any ideas? Thanks.
